zoty中欧体育平台

首页网站制作如何制作软件

如何制作软件

zoty中欧体育平台 2023-12-16 08:15 发布于昆明

在线咨询 联系

当今社会,软件已经成为人们生活和工作中不可或缺的部分,无论是手机应用、电脑软件还是互联网平台,软件的制作都是一个非常重要的过程。zoty中欧体育平台 将对软件制作进行详解,带你了解软件制作的全过程。

1. 需求分析

在制作软件之前,首先需要进行需求分析。这是确定软件功能和特性的关键步骤。通过与用户的沟通和调研,开发团队可以了解用户的需求和期望,从而确定软件的功能和界面设计。

用户调研

用户调研是需求分析的关键环节。通过与用户的交流和访谈,开发团队可以了解用户的使用习惯、喜好和痛点,从而为软件的功能和设计提供参考。

功能规划

根据用户需求和市场需求,开发团队需要对软件的功能进行规划。这包括确定软件的核心功能、附加功能和扩展功能等,以满足用户的需求。

界面设计

软件的界面设计是用户体验的重要组成部分。通过合理的布局、美观的界面和易用的操作,可以提高用户的满意度和使用体验。

2. 编码开发

在需求分析完成后,开发团队将开始进行编码开发。这是将软件的功能和设计转化为实际代码的过程。

编程语言选择

根据软件的需求和开发团队的技术能力,选择合适的编程语言进行开发。常用的编程语言包括Java、Python、C++等。

模块开发

软件的功能通常可以分为多个模块进行开发。开发团队可以根据功能的复杂程度和优先级,将软件的开发过程分为多个阶段,逐步完成各个模块的开发。

调试测试

在编码开发过程中,开发团队需要进行调试和测试,以确保软件的功能正常运行。这包括单元测试、集成测试和系统测试等,以发现和修复潜在的问题。

3. 用户体验优化

软件的用户体验是决定用户是否愿意使用的重要因素。开发团队需要通过不断优化和改进,提高软件的用户体验。

界面优化

通过优化软件的界面设计、布局和交互效果,提高用户的操作便利性和视觉体验。

响应速度优化

软件的响应速度对用户体验有着重要影响。开发团队需要通过优化代码和算法,提高软件的运行效率,减少卡顿和延迟。

功能完善

根据用户的反馈和需求,开发团队需要不断完善软件的功能,以满足用户的需求和期望。

4. 测试与发布

在软件制作完成后,开发团队需要进行测试和发布,确保软件的质量和稳定性。

功能测试

对软件的各项功能进行测试,确保功能的正确性和稳定性。这包括功能的正常运行、数据的准确性和界面的稳定性等。

兼容性测试

测试软件在不同操作系统、不同设备和不同网络环境下的兼容性,以确保软件在不同平台上的稳定运行。

发布与反馈

在测试通过后,开发团队可以将软件发布到相应的应用商店或互联网平台上。鼓励用户提供反馈和建议,以进一步改进软件的质量和用户体验。

5. 后续维护与更新

软件制作并不是一次性的过程,开发团队需要进行后续的维护和更新,以保证软件的功能和性能持续改进。

Bug修复

根据用户的反馈和测试结果,开发团队需要及时修复软件中存在的Bug,确保软件的稳定性和可靠性。

功能更新

随着用户需求和市场变化,开发团队需要不断更新软件的功能,以满足用户的新需求和提升竞争力。

性能优化

通过优化代码和算法,提高软件的性能和响应速度,以提升用户的使用体验。

软件制作是一个复杂而又精细的过程,需要经过需求分析、编码开发、用户体验优化、测试与发布以及后续维护与更新等多个环节。只有通过不断努力和优化,才能制作出高质量、稳定可靠的软件,满足用户的需求和期望。

  • document.write("") 易倍体育下载app@emc全站易倍 易倍体育官网入口app|全站app下载 易倍体育官方网站@emc体育全站 台北外送茶 EMC易倍体育官方 外送茶